There is so much you can go hyper into with most of what you just mentioned - for the most part, "in that area" is what you're going to need and notice. So don't stress it. 1) Do not carry ball ammo 2) The aim of carrying is to stop the threat should the need arise. 3) Ball, whilst humane in the wound it creates, is inefficient at "stopping the threat" for the same reason. I stick to big name brands and commercial ammo to cover my ass, one that your local LEO's use is good. Having said that, i just just Hornady Critical Defence or Duty (Duty is a heavier round) usually whichever is on sale, a good price is $20 or under for the box of 25. I do carry a 9 as it's always concealed. I have also found that my Hornady rounds seem to have the same point of impact as my ball ammo when i practise, at least it's close enough for me to practise with ball 9/10 times.
